Hi All, my wife and I have decided to start right sizing as retirement nears.  As part of that, I have just placed over 3/4’s of the knives I own (from my and my deceased father’s collections) up for sale at a local on line auction house.  For sale are: 29 fixed blade mostly custom hunting and fishing knives by makers  including George Herron, Randall, Corbett Sigman, GW Stone, Owens and Morseth.  14 folding blades including 2 beautiful Shaw-Leibovitz, and one by Barry Wood.  Plus 3 each slip joint and boot knives.  Finally, a samurai sword my dad had stashed in a drawer.  The online auction is in early December 2021 and is being held by www.leonardauction.com, a local business my extended family has used before for estates.  My knife items (I have other collections also for sale) start on page 15 through 17, items 385 to 417.  The catalogue has been posted with lots of good photos.

Take a look you may see something you like.  I hope this is the correct place to post. Thanks.
